Five rockets fired at the airport were intercepted apparently by the US’s CRAM defenses, local sources reported.

Witnesses said they heard the sound of three explosions and then saw a flash in the sky.

“National Security Adviser Jake Sullivan and Chief of Staff Ron Klain have briefed the President on the rocket attack at Hamid Karzai International Airport. The President was informed that operations continue uninterrupted at HKIA, and has reconfirmed his order that commanders redouble their efforts to prioritize doing whatever is necessary to protect our forces on the ground,” the White House said in the statement.

No group immediately claimed responsibility for the attack. (ILKHA)
